Product Description

Troy Van Leeuwen is one of rock's most idiosyncratic guitarists. Renowned for his work with Queens of the Stone Age, Van Leeuwen has also made unique musical contributions to several high-profile alternative bands - including Failure, A Perfect Circle and Puscifer. To cover all of this diverse sonic territory, a versatile instrument is necessary - and Van Leeuwen's signature Fender Jazzmaster covers all of the bases.

Classic Fender Construction

In typical Fender fashion, the Troy Van Leeuwen Signature Jazzmaster features an Alder body. This balanced-sounding material ensures robust lows, lively mids and crisp highs; the perfect tonal foundation for the jangly-sounding single-coil pickups.

The Alder body is joined with a bolt-on Maple neck, bringing out plenty of pronounced top-end. Shaped to Fender's standard "C” profile, the Troy Van Leeuwen Jazzmaster's neck strikes the perfect balance between a contemporary and vintage feel. A Maple fingerboard is in-keeping with the light aesthetic, with black block inlays offering a retro '70s vibe.

Pure Vintage '65 Pickups

Fender's stunning Troy Van Leeuwen Jazzmaster achieves its old-school sounds from its Pure Vintage '65 single-coil pickups. With a vibrant and punchy character, these medium-output pickups excel with clean amp settings but also sound dynamic and potent with overdrive and distortion. This alternative all-star guitar really is suitable for a wide range of styles!

Time-Honoured Hardware

Many of the distinctive hardware appointments found on original Jazzmasters from the '60s have been retained for this particular artist model. Fitted with a vintage-style "Floating" tremolo tailpiece, you can embellish lush chords and intricate licks with some eerie, atmospheric warble.

A Jazzmaster bridge with nickel-plated brass Mustang saddles ensures excellent tuning stability with extended tremolo use, while enable excellent access for action and intonation tweaks.

Specifications

Body

  • Body Material: Alder
  • Body Finish: Gloss Polyester
  • Body Shape: Jazzmaster

Neck

  • Neck Material: Maple
  • Neck Finish: Gloss Polyester
  • Neck Shape: "C" Shape
  • Scale Length: 25.5"
  • Fingerboard Material: Maple
  • Fingerboard Radius: 7.25" (184.1 mm)
  • Number of Frets: 21
  • Fret Size: Vintage Style
  • Nut Material: Synthetic Bone
  • Nut Width: 1.650" (42 mm)
  • Position Inlays: Black Block

Electronics

  • Bridge Pickup: Pure Vintage '65 Single-Coil Jazzmaster
  • Neck Pickup: Pure Vintage '65 Single-Coil Jazzmaster
  • Controls: Master Volume, Master Tone
  • Switching: 3-Position Toggle: Position 1. Bridge Pickup, Position 2. Bridge and Neck Pickups, Position 3. Neck Pickup; 2-Position Slide: Up: Rhythm Tone Circuit, Down: Lead Tone Circuit

Hardware

  • Bridge: Jazzmaster Bridge with Nickel-Plated Brass Mustang Saddles and Vintage Style "Floating" Tremolo Tailpiece
  • Hardware Finish: Nickel/Chrome
  • Tuning Machines: Vintage-Style
  • Pickguard: 4-Ply Tortoiseshell
  • Control Knobs: Vintage White "Witch Hat"

Miscellaneous

  • Case/Gig Bag: Deluxe Hardshell
  • Strings: Fender USA 250L Nickel Plated Steel (.009-.042 Gauges)
